Why celebrities pursue extreme or unusual regimens
Celebrities operate under compressed timelines and unusual incentives. A film role may demand rapid muscle gain or dramatic fat loss; a tour or photoshoot creates pressure to maintain a specific look; brand-building and personal philosophy drive public promotion of certain wellness trends. Access to top trainers, nutritionists, and new interventions lowers the barrier to experimentation. Wealth buys convenience, not immunity from risk.
Two consistent drivers explain many extreme choices. First, acute goals create short-term justification for practices that would be unsustainable or unhealthy long term—rapid weight-cutting before a role is a classic example. Second, the social and commercial value of uniqueness rewards novelty: being known for an odd practice draws attention that can translate into projects, followers, or product sales.
Understanding these motivations clarifies why some routines make sense in circumscribed contexts while others become problematic when imported into everyday life.
Early rising and hyper-structured days: discipline as optimization (Mark Wahlberg)
Mark Wahlberg’s routine—waking before 3:00 a.m., praying, completing multiple workouts and meals, then starting professional duties—illustrates a principle familiar to athletes and executives: compressing productive hours into a long, structured morning. Early rising allows for training and recovery windows that accommodate demanding schedules.
Physiology and practical trade-offs
- Cortisol tends to peak in the morning, which can aid wakefulness and performance for early workouts. Training in the morning may help create consistent sleep-wake patterns when paired with stable bedtimes.
- Pushing wake times to 2–3 a.m. can reduce total sleep unless bedtimes shift earlier. Chronic sleep restriction impairs cognitive function, metabolic health, immune response, and recovery—offsetting gains from extra training.
- Morning routines that include proper nutrition and staged workouts can be effective when sleep is adequate and the plan is periodized. Discipline is beneficial, but it should not become sleep deprivation disguised as productivity.
Real-world application
- Shift the schedule gradually if trying earlier training: advance bedtime by 15–30 minutes every few days.
- Prioritize sleep quality—dark room, consistent bedtime, limited screens before sleep—so early starts don’t erode recovery.
Exclusionary eating and bespoke diets: when elimination becomes identity (Tom Brady, Madonna, Kourtney Kardashian)
Several celebrities favor diets defined by omission. Tom Brady popularized the TB12 approach, which emphasizes hydration, plant-forward choices, and avoidance of certain foods categorized as inflammatory—Tom’s list commonly includes tomatoes, peppers, eggplant, and mushrooms. Madonna’s long association with macrobiotic-inspired eating prioritizes whole grains, vegetables, and selected seasonings; Kourtney Kardashian’s organic, avocado-forward experiments reflect another personalized elimination approach.
Mechanisms and limitations
- Eliminating processed sugar and ultra-processed foods almost universally improves diet quality and reduces cardiometabolic risk. Avoiding allergens or genuine sensitivities benefits those affected.
- Avoiding entire food groups without medical reason risks nutrient gaps. For example, excluding all nightshades (tomatoes, peppers, eggplant) on the assumption that they universally inflame is not supported by robust evidence; only a minority experience nightshade-related sensitivities.
- Macrobiotic diets can be rich in fiber and plant nutrients but may be low in certain micronutrients (vitamin B12, iron, calcium) unless carefully planned.
Practical guidance
- When eliminating foods, document symptoms and consider an elimination-challenge under professional supervision to identify true sensitivities.
- If highly restrictive, supplement strategically (e.g., B12 for those on plant-exclusive diets) and monitor biomarkers when changes are long-term.
Very low body fat for performance: the unsustainable role diet (Zac Efron, Hugh Jackman)
Actors often undergo intense body recomposition. Zac Efron’s prep for Baywatch and Hugh Jackman’s transformations for physically demanding roles combine strict diet, heavy resistance training, and sometimes intermittent fasting to achieve stage-ready leanness.
Why extreme leanness is temporary
- To reach very low body fat percentages, caloric intake must be reduced and energy expenditure raised—sustainable only briefly. Prolonged caloric deficits impair hormonal balance (testosterone, thyroid hormones), sleep, mood, and immunity.
- Rapid changes in body composition can be necessary for roles but usually require post-production recovery windows to restore hormonal and metabolic homeostasis.
Safer approaches for performers and the general public
- Periodize intake: use planned phases for cutting and refeeding, guided by a sports nutritionist.
- Prioritize protein, strength training, and slow weight changes—0.5–1% body weight loss per week reduces catabolism.
- Monitor mental health and bone density if repeated cycles of extreme dieting occur.
Cold immersion, the Wim Hof influence, and resilience training (Chris Hemsworth)
Chris Hemsworth’s use of ice baths aligns with growing interest in cold exposure as a recovery and resilience tool. Athletes report reduced muscle soreness and perceived recovery benefits after cold-water immersion.
Physiological effects
- Cold exposure reduces local inflammation and can blunt delayed onset muscle soreness (DOMS) by constricting blood vessels and reducing metabolic activity in tissues.
- Repeated cold exposure may activate sympathetic responses and increase norepinephrine, which can sharpen alertness.
- For hypertrophy-focused athletes, frequent post-exercise cold immersion may blunt some training adaptations by reducing inflammatory signaling needed for muscle growth.
Safety and best practices
- Limit exposure time and water temperature according to experience: novice protocols typically start with short durations (1–3 minutes) at moderate cold and progress slowly.
- Those with cardiovascular disease or uncontrolled hypertension should consult a physician; cold immersion can provoke arrhythmias or excessive blood pressure rises in susceptible individuals.
Broader context
- The Wim Hof method popularized cold exposure combined with breathing techniques. When practiced responsibly, it can offer mental and subjective resilience benefits; unsupervised extreme exposure carries real risk.
Breath-holding and extreme physiological conditioning (David Blaine)
David Blaine’s endurance stunts demonstrate how deliberate breath-hold training and physiological conditioning can extend human limits. Elite free divers use similar protocols—CO2 tolerance training, relaxation techniques, and progressive immersion—to increase apnea times.
How breath-hold conditioning works
- Training increases tolerance to rising CO2 and falling oxygen, and develops mental techniques to suppress the urge to breathe.
- Physiological adaptations include splenic contraction (releasing red blood cells), bradycardia (slower heart rate), and peripheral vasoconstriction that redistributes oxygen to vital organs.
Risks
- Loss of consciousness due to hypoxia—particularly in water—poses a drowning hazard. “Shallow-water blackout” can occur during breath-hold swimming after hyperventilation, which suppresses CO2-driven breathing urge while oxygen levels drop dangerously low.
- Breath-hold training should be supervised by experienced instructors and never practiced alone in water.
Practical takeaway
- Controlled breath-hold exercises on land, with spotters and progressive approaches, can be safe for trained individuals. Water practice requires strict safety protocols.
Unusual ingestibles: clay, oil pulling, and geophagy (Shailene Woodley, Gwyneth Paltrow)
Shailene Woodley once shared experiences with edible clay, a practice known as geophagy found in multiple cultures and sometimes used for mineral supplementation or perceived digestive benefits. Gwyneth Paltrow’s promotion of oil pulling—a traditional Ayurvedic technique involving swishing oil in the mouth—illustrates how ancestral practices enter mainstream wellness.
Evidence and concerns
- Geophagy occurs worldwide and can provide mineral intake in settings of deficiency, but commercial clay may contain contaminants (heavy metals) and harbor pathogens if not processed safely. Clay can also bind medications and reduce absorption.
- Oil pulling has limited evidence for reducing oral bacterial load and plaque compared with standard oral hygiene. It may complement but should not replace brushing and flossing.
- Both practices highlight a tension between historical/traditional remedies and modern evidence-based standards.
Advice
- Avoid ingesting any non-food clay without verified laboratory testing for contaminants. Discuss medication timing with a clinician if trying mineral-rich earth-derived products.
- Maintain standard dental care while using oil pulling as an adjunct if desired; consult a dentist about cavity risk and gum health.
The carnivore experiment and extreme elimination (Joe Rogan)
Joe Rogan publicly experimented with the carnivore diet—consuming predominantly or exclusively animal-based foods—for limited periods. Proponents report improvements in inflammatory conditions or energy. Critics point to risks of missing fiber, phytonutrients, and diverse microbiome inputs.
Scientific perspective
- Short-term improvements in weight and some metabolic markers can follow a high-protein, low-carbohydrate approach, especially if the previous diet was high in processed foods.
- Long-term adherence to a diet lacking plant fiber can reduce microbial diversity and short-chain fatty acid production, which support gut barrier function and systemic health.
- Nutrient shortfalls (vitamin C, certain phytonutrients) require attention; some carnivore adherents argue minimal needs satisfied by organ meats, but that requires careful sourcing and planning.
Guidance for those curious
- Try elimination for short, defined periods while monitoring symptoms and key labs (lipids, kidney function, micronutrients). Consult a clinician if you have pre-existing conditions like kidney disease.
- If symptoms improve, consider reintroducing specific plant groups to identify triggers while preserving dietary diversity where possible.
Intermittent fasting and time-restricted eating (Jared Leto, Hugh Jackman)
Intermittent fasting (IF) appears in several celebrity practices as a tool to modulate weight and body composition. Jared Leto has attributed parts of his youthful appearance to moderation and intermittent fasting; Hugh Jackman combined fasting strategies with focused resistance training.
Mechanisms and outcomes
- Time-restricted eating (e.g., 8–10 hour eating windows) aligns food intake with circadian rhythms for some people, which can improve insulin sensitivity and support weight control.
- Alternate-day fasting and prolonged fasts produce more pronounced metabolic shifts but increase risk of nutrient deficiency and energy imbalance if not managed.
- Benefits depend on total caloric intake, food quality, and individual metabolic response rather than fasting alone.
Practical implementation
- For many, a 10–12 hour overnight fast is a low-risk way to obtain benefits while preserving social eating patterns.
- Athletes and people with high energy needs should time nutrient intake around workouts to support performance and recovery.

Supplements, self-tracking, and the quantified life (Bryan Johnson)
Bryan Johnson’s publicized longevity routine, involving strict meal timing, numerous supplements, frequent bloodwork, and algorithm-driven lifestyle modifications, exemplifies the “quantified self” applied to longevity.
What the data-driven approach offers
- Frequent monitoring can reveal trajectories in blood pressure, lipids, glucose regulation, and inflammatory markers, enabling tailored interventions.
- Certain lifestyle modifications—smoking cessation, activity, healthy sleep, and diet—produce clear and reproducible improvements in biomarkers.
Limits and concerns
- Many supplement stacks lack strong evidence for long-term benefit and may interact with medications or create nutrient excess.
- Intensive daily routines and intrusive monitoring may not translate into meaningful lifespan extension; improvements in surrogate markers do not always equate to reduced mortality.
- Cost and the psychological burden of constant measurement are barriers for most people.
Practical translation
- Regular health checks and targeted testing are useful; choose validated interventions first (dietary improvements, exercise, sleep).
- Approach supplement regimens critically, with clinician oversight and periodic reassessment for necessity and safety.
Recovery, moderation, and the myth of one-size-fits-all routines
Recovery practices such as ice baths, cryotherapy, massage, and compression garments are common among performers. These tools reduce perceived soreness and may speed return to training, but overreliance can blunt training adaptations if misapplied.
Balance matters
- Recovery tools support high training loads when used thoughtfully. They are not substitutes for sleep, nutrition, or progressive training programming.
- Individual response varies; what helps one athlete function better may hinder another’s adaptation.
Guidance
- Match recovery to goal: use cold immersion after repeated endurance events or high-volume sessions to reduce inflammation when immediate recovery matters; avoid routine cold immersion when focusing on hypertrophy that relies on inflammatory signaling for growth.
- Prioritize restorative sleep and protein intake as foundational recovery measures before layering on additional modalities.

How to evaluate a celebrity health claim in five steps
- Identify the claim precisely. Is it a dietary rule, a device, or a behavioral change?
- Look for independent evidence beyond testimonials: randomized trials, meta-analyses, or professional consensus statements.
- Check for conflicts of interest: is the celebrity selling a product or service tied to the claim?
- Assess risk relative to your health: could the practice interact with medications or pre-existing conditions?
- Start small, monitor outcomes, and consult a qualified clinician before long-term adoption.
FAQ
Q: Are any celebrity wellness practices universally recommended? A: No single celebrity practice fits everyone. However, several celebrity-endorsed principles align with mainstream guidance: reducing processed sugar, prioritizing sleep, incorporating strength training, and emphasizing dietary quality. These offer broad benefits without the risks tied to extreme regimens.
Q: Is cold-water immersion beneficial for everyone? A: Cold immersion can reduce soreness and provide short-term recovery benefits for many athletes. It carries cardiovascular risks for people with heart disease or uncontrolled hypertension and may blunt muscle growth if used immediately after strength sessions. Consult a clinician and start with conservative exposure times.
Q: Does intermittent fasting improve longevity or metabolism reliably? A: Time-restricted eating and intermittent fasting can improve insulin sensitivity and support weight management in many people. Long-term effects on human lifespan are not conclusively proven. Effects depend on overall calorie intake, diet quality, and individual variation.
Q: Can the carnivore diet be healthy long term? A: Long-term carnivore diets risk deficits in fiber and certain micronutrients and may reduce gut microbial diversity. Some individuals report symptom improvement, but the scientific community lacks high-quality long-term data to recommend exclusive animal-based diets for general populations.
Q: Is oil pulling effective for dental health? A: Oil pulling may reduce oral bacteria and plaque marginally but does not replace brushing, flossing, and professional dental care. Use as a supplementary practice only.
Q: Are breath-holding and apnea training safe to practice? A: Breath-hold training can be practiced safely on land with supervision and progressive protocols. Never practice breath-hold exercises alone in water; risk of blackout and drowning is real.
Q: How should one approach celebrity-endorsed longevity programs involving many supplements and frequent tests? A: Prioritize established lifestyle interventions (exercise, sleep, balanced diet, smoking cessation). If pursuing intensive monitoring or supplements, consult clinicians, focus on evidence-supported tests, and reassess utility and cost periodically.
Q: If I want a dramatic body transformation like in films, what’s a safer approach? A: Work with a qualified sports nutritionist and trainer to plan staged changes with medical oversight. Use periodized dieting and refeeding phases, ensure adequate protein for muscle preservation, and monitor mental and hormonal health.
Q: What are warning signs that a wellness trend is harmful? A: Red flags include extreme restriction, claims of single-cause cures, lack of independent evidence, significant costs with proprietary products, and practices requiring isolation or secrecy. Consult a healthcare professional if the regimen affects mood, sleep, menstrual cycles, or energy dramatically.
Q: How can I stay informed without getting swept up in trends? A: Follow reputable sources—peer-reviewed journals, clinical society statements, and health professionals with credentials. Maintain healthy skepticism, ask for evidence beyond anecdotes, and test changes conservatively with measurement and professional guidance.
